Staff at our hospitals have been reminiscing about meeting and treating King Charles over the past 30 years – and remember him as “the ideal patient”.
On 11 January 1989, the then Prince Charles visited the Queen’s Medical Centre to meet survivors of the Kegworth air disaster and to chat with staff who cared for them.
